Mania 35 Match Of The Night Betting Update For March 28th

In the most recent post, I had a look over the adjustments that have been made to some of Kambi's Wrestling Observer Newsletter star ratings prop markets. I now intend to point out the differences to the 'Highest Rated Match of the Night' special that's also available from the sportsbooks with Kambi pricing.

As with the prop specials, Kambi republished its 'Highest Rated' market yesterday. When I last wrote about the selections a week ago, the bookie had the 'Raw Women's Championship' and 'WWE Championship' as joint 9/4 favourites to get the most stars in Dave Meltzer's review of the event.

In the week that has followed, the Raw Women's Championship match has been confirmed as being the main event of the evening and - on top of that - Charlotte Flair is now the WWE Smackdown Women's Champion. This week's issue of the Observer reports that Flair's title will also be on the line in the match and the rules of which will become clear on Monday's edition of Raw.

The 'Raw Women's Championship' selection is now the sole favourite. It's 2/1. The WWE Championship match - which has finally been confirmed as Daniel Bryan .vs. Kofi Kingston - is still at last week's price.

There have been other price cuts since last week.

The option to bet on 'Any Male Tag Match' has been moved to 17/2 from 10/1, Triple H .vs. Batista (now with an added stipulation that Triple H has to retire if he were to lose) is now down to 10/1 from 12s, and Shane McMahon .vs. The Miz - which has now been set as a falls count anywhere match - is 15/1 from 20/1.

With the selections moving in, Kambi has increased the Cruiserweight Championship bout (4/1 to 5/1), US Championship (4/1 to 5/1) and the Andre the Giant Memorial Battle Royal (50/1 to 66/1).

'Any Women's Match Except The Raw Women's Championship' has been removed. It was 66/1 last week. I surmise this is because the Smackdown Women's Championship has technically become the current favourite following Charlotte Flair's win now that it's likely going to be on the line in the same match as the Raw Women's Championship.

I guess the 'Any Unlisted Match' will now cover the Women's Tag Team Championship, although - before this week - it would be covered by the 'Any Women Match Except Raw Women's Championship'.

With all that said, looking at what the women's tag match is up against on the card, I doubt there's going to be any sort of post-Mania betting controversy.
